#58b26b h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#58b26b is composed of 34.5% red, 69.8%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.9%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.7 degrees, a saturation of 36.9% and a lightness of 52.2%. #58b26b color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ffd6 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#58b26b color description : Dark moderate lime green.

The hexadecimal color #58b26b has RGB values of R:88, G:178,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 5812843.

Hex triplet 58b26b #58b26b
RGB Decimal 88, 178, 107 rgb(88,178,107)
RGB Percent 34.5, 69.8, 42 rgb(34.5%,69.8%,42%)
CMYK 51, 0, 40, 30
HSL 132.7°, 36.9, 52.2 hsl(132.7,36.9%,52.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 132.7°, 50.6, 69.8
Web Safe 669966 #669966
CIE-LAB 65.73, -42.533, 28.238
XYZ 22.598, 34.975, 19.469
xyY 0.293, 0.454, 34.975
CIE-LCH 65.73, 51.054, 146.419
CIE-LUV 65.73, -41.521, 43.931
Hunter-Lab 59.14, -35.29, 21.879
Binary 01011000, 10110010, 01101011

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030804 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fa is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8c81 is the less saturated color, while #0dfd40 is the most saturated one.

Below, you can see how #58b26b is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y

  • #8f8f8f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#849688 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population

Dichromacy

  • #b2a46c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c19e7a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#74adb9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population

Trichromacy

  • #91a96b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9ba575 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#6aaf9d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
